An earth moving equipment mechanic is responsible for the maintenance, repair, and servicing of heavy machinery used in construction, mining, and other earth-moving operations. These mechanics specialize in diagnosing and troubleshooting mechanical issues, conducting routine inspections, and performing necessary repairs to ensure the safe and efficient functioning of the equipment. They work with a variety of machines such as bulldozers, excavators, graders, and loaders, and are skilled in using diagnostic tools and equipment to identify problems. They also have knowledge of hydraulic, electrical, and diesel systems, and are capable of repairing and replacing faulty components. This occupation requires strong technical skills, attention to detail, and the ability to work independently or as part of a team.

Earth Moving Equipment Mechanic salary in South Africa
Average Yearly Salary of Earth Moving Equipment Mechanic in South Africa is approximately 128,175 ZAR (6,450 USD). Data is for 2025 and indicates a pre-tax value. The salary itself depends on multiple factors such as seniority, job performance, certifications, experience or any other bonuses. The value indicated is an average amount based on records we have in database. Real values may vary. The data is for orientational purposes.
